**Vendor note: Inkmill markdown pipeline**

Rendering for Parchway docs is outsourced to Inkmill under an annual contract, renewing each March. They handle sanitization and PDF export; we own the upload queue. SLA: 4-hour response on rendering failures. Escalate only after two failed retries. Their support desk is reachable at the address below.

billing contact of hahaf-baguf = zorael.tammir.jorius@sivrelhq.internal

Quarterly Planning Note — Capacity at the Brindlehaven Plant

Team, quick update before the Q3 push. We've decided to hold off expanding line three at Brindlehaven until demand for the Coravel range firms up. That means order lead times stay at six weeks, so please set expectations with customers accordingly. Renna will circulate updated quota sheets on Friday. For context on where this fits in the bigger picture, see the confidential note below.

confidential, kagep-kahof: Druokax Systems plans to lower the Ulaath list price by 53 percent in March.

Minutes — Management Meeting (circulated to branch managers)

Attendees: Corin Val, Inka Strade, Bram Osset.

The proposed sale of the Fennel Creek logistics unit was reviewed. Two offers received; the higher bid includes retention terms for depot staff. Legal review of warranties continues. Branch operations are unaffected until completion; continue routing shipments as normal. No external comment is authorised. A decision is expected within four weeks. Background on the broader plan follows.

management briefing: Project Ulavan slips by two quarters because of the staffing delay.